StubHub (STUB) has been sued by the US Federal Trade Commission for allegedly failing to display full ticket prices to consumers, Bloomberg reported Thursday, citing a complaint filed in a New York federal court.
The agency said StubHub didn't disclose mandatory fees and charges until the final checkout screen, despite rules in place since 2025 requiring ticket sellers to show "all-in" pricing upfront, the report said.
StubHub did not immediately reply to a request for comment from MT Newswires.
